Common J.river.media.center.19.x-patch.exe Errors on Windows
Encountering errors associated with j.river.media.center.19.x-patch.exe can be frustrating. These errors may vary in nature and can surface due to different reasons, such as software conflicts, outdated drivers, or even malware infections. Below, we've outlined the most commonly reported errors linked to j.river.media.center.19.x-patch.exe, to aid in understanding and potentially resolving the issues at hand.
- J.river.media.center.19.x-patch.exe Application Error: This error message indicates a problem encountered by the executable application during its execution. This could be due to software bugs, corrupted files, or conflicts with other programs.
- Not a Valid Win32 Application: This error surfaces when a program cannot be initiated because it's not compatible with the version of Windows being used, or the file itself might be corrupt.
- J.river.media.center.19.x-patch.exe - System Error: This alert appears when the execution of j.river.media.center.19.x-patch.exe causes a system issue. Possible causes might include clashes with other software, damaged system files, or insufficient system resources.
- Insufficient System Resources Exist to Complete the Requested Service: This warning is displayed when there are not enough system resources available to execute the service required. This can happen when there is an overconsumption of system memory or high CPU demand.
- Unable to Start Correctly (0xc000007b): This warning is shown when the application fails to start as it should, typically caused by an inconsistency between the 32-bit and 64-bit versions of the application and the Windows operating system.

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the j.river.media.center.19.x-patch.exe Error
![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the j.river.media.center.19.x-patch.exe Error Thumbnail](https://cdn.techloris.com/library/media/sfc-scan.jpg)
In this guide, we will attempt to fix the j.river.media.center.19.x-patch.exe error by scanning Windows system files.
![Step 1: Open Command Prompt Thumbnail](https://cdn.techloris.com/library/media/command-prompt.jpg)
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Command Prompt
in the search bar. -
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.
![Step 2: Run SFC Scan Thumbnail](https://cdn.techloris.com/library/media/sfc-scan.jpg)
-
In the Command Prompt window, type
sfc /scannow
and press Enter. -
Allow the System File Checker to scan your system for errors.
Run the Windows Check Disk Utility
![Run the Windows Check Disk Utility Thumbnail](https://cdn.techloris.com/library/media/check-disk.jpg)
How to use the Windows Check Disk Utility. Scans your disk for j.river.media.center.19.x-patch.exe errors and automatically fix them.
![Step 1: Open the Command Prompt Thumbnail](https://cdn.techloris.com/library/media/command-prompt.jpg)
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Command Prompt
in the search bar and press Enter. -
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.
![Step 2: Run Check Disk Utility Thumbnail](https://cdn.techloris.com/library/media/check-disk.jpg)
-
In the Command Prompt window, type
chkdsk /f
and press Enter. -
If the system reports that it cannot run the check because the disk is in use, type
Y
and press Enter to schedule the check for the next system restart.
![Step 3: Restart Your Computer Thumbnail](https://cdn.techloris.com/library/media/restart-computer.jpg)
-
If you had to schedule the check, restart your computer for the check to be performed.
